Data Science Platform Market Research, 2030
Data science framework comprises the software center in which all aspects of data science work take place, including the incorporation and exploration of data from different sources, coding, and models of construction. It also leverages the data, deploys models into development, and through model-powered applications or reports, it serves outcomes. It helps data scientists to uncover actionable insights from data within a single environment, prepare a strategy, and communicate the collected ideas within an organization. Data science includes several work names, ranging from analytics officer, actuary, to research scientist, through numerous industries and organizations. All four phases of the data science production line are assisted by the Data Science platform: data planning, model creation, DevOps, and business delivery. It is focused on open access to data, consistent metadata, good corporate governance, automated machine learning and model building, operationalized model management, and tools that measure and improve its impact on business.

Global Data Science Platform Market: Market Dynamics
Drivers
Growing inclination of enterprises toward data-intensive business strategies
The increasing focus of companies on ease-of-use methods to drive business and the need to obtain in-depth insights from voluminous data to gain a competitive edge are key growth drivers for the industry. Companies are increasingly inclined towards data-intensive business strategies and increasing adoption of advanced technology to generate many opportunities for data science platform vendors. The market for data science platforms is primarily driven by the rapid growth of big data technology, growing demand for technologies to increase operational performance, and increasing acceptance of big data analytics to gain insights into customer purchasing behavior and buying trends.
Rising adoption of advanced technologies
Data science is opening up huge opportunities to learn unnoticed trends of customer buying. These trends allow businesses to understand key insights to help their company run effectively, target potential customers, and deliver better services. In addition, business analytics tools are being embraced by businesses that can deliver effective results from a broad collection of data, which in turn is fueling the growth of the market for data science platforms. Funding and enormous investments by the public and private sectors in the production of big data and related technologies are expected to fuel the growth of the data science platform market.
Restraint
Lack of privacy and security
Lack of technological reliability, stringent government rules and regulations, data protection and privacy concerns and enormous investment requirements are key factors hindering the growth of the data science platform industry. Users of this technology will need to upgrade their platform on a regular basis to make it effective with advanced data resources and technologies, which is a key challenge for market growth. In the data science platform industry, data explosion, lack of domain knowledge and lack of analytical capabilities are few challenges.

Recently, various developments have been taking place in the market. For instance, In July 2019, Microsoft released Microsoft Machine Learning Server 9.4. This platform provides Python function libraries and R for ML and data science. It also contains updates for R and Python engines with additional Spark 2.4 and CDH 6.1 support.
